如何在java中使用另一个堆栈来反转堆栈
嗨,我正在尝试使用另一个空堆栈来反转堆栈(我自己编写的一个堆栈)。 由于某种原因,它无法正常工作。 谁能帮我这个 ?
public static void main(String[] args) { Stack stack1 = new Stack(); //filling the stack with numbers from 0 to 4 for(int i = 0; i 0){ reverse.push(stack1.pop()); }
while(!stack1.isEmpty()){ Integer value = (Integer)stack1.pop(); System.out.println(value); reverse.push(value); }
- 我该怎么玩MP3文件?
- 如何从JSP页面引用java .class文件?
- 派生类可访问性
- 如何更改Java中的默认语言环境设置以使它们保持一致?
- 从C#迁移到Java的提示?
- RMI注册表问题:使用“file:”URL方案绑定代码库时,rmiregistry可能会导致意外exception
- 当@Context用于setter / field / constructor注入时,HK2 Factory在Jerseyfilter之前调用
- 如何为saas软件提供cname前向支持
- 无法传输工件(https://repo.maven.apache.org/maven2):收到致命警报:protocol_version – >